Job Summary
Order materials and supplies efficiently, ensuring accuracy and timely delivery prior to scheduled installation. Coordinate with vendors to determine product availability, pricing, and terms of sale, while analyzing systems to assess future material needs. Utilize ERP systems for placing orders, tracking materials, and running daily purchasing and material reports. Conduct root cause analysis on purchasing issues and recommend process improvements. Collaborate with Design, Operations, and Field partners to coordinate homebuyer material approvals and ensure samples are available. Assist with training for Purchasing Associates and take on special projects to support continuous improvement initiatives.
